兩種方法刪除github遠端倉庫裡的檔案(不改變本地倉庫)
方法一(假如你要刪除的資料夾在你的本地倉庫也存在):
前提:假如你要刪除的資料夾在你的本地倉庫也存在,當然你也可以直接在github客戶端把本地倉庫更新一下,這樣你的本地倉庫裡就有你要刪除的檔案了,然後你在刪除,就到了下一步。
直接在本地倉庫刪除那個檔案,這個時候你的github客戶端會捕捉到你的操作:
提交修改,然後更新到遠端倉庫,就可以了。
方法二:在你本地倉庫目錄下,Git Base here
$ dir //看看當前目錄下存在的檔案
$ git rm -r --cached jk.txt //這裡假如刪除的是jk.txt
$ git commit -m '刪除了測試檔案' //提交修改,並做描述
$ git push -u origin master //修改遠端倉庫
相關推薦
兩種方法刪除github遠端倉庫裡的檔案(不改變本地倉庫)
方法一(假如你要刪除的資料夾在你的本地倉庫也存在): 前提:假如你要刪除的資料夾在你的本地倉庫也存在,當然你也可以直接在github客戶端把本地倉庫更新一下,這樣你的本地倉庫裡就有你要刪除的檔案了,然後你在刪除,就到了下一步。 直接在本地倉庫刪除那個檔案,這個時候你的github客戶端會捕捉
兩種超詳細的遠端連線工具介紹(從安裝到使用)
眾所周知,個人電腦與伺服器不同,伺服器一般都是執行在IDC機房中,我們通常不會直接接觸到伺服器硬體,而是通過各種遠端方式對伺服器進行控制。於是遠端連線工具便應運而生了,下面簡單介紹一種常用的 linux 連線工具。 一、 Notepad++ Notepad++是一套非常有特色的自由
iOS兩種方法刪除NSUserDefaults所有記錄
//方法一 NSString *appDomain = [[NSBundlemainBundle] bundleIdentifier];[[NSUserDefaults standardUser
微信小程式彈出loading層的兩種方法:直接在程式碼裡控制,在wxml檔案里布局彈窗loading層,利用條件渲染,在js程式碼裡控制是否顯示loading層。
微信小程式彈出loading層的兩種方法:直接在程式碼裡控制,在wxml檔案里布局彈窗loading層,利用條件渲染,在js程式碼裡控制是否顯示loading層。 直接在程式碼裡控制 js程式碼 showLoading:function(){ wx.showToast({
兩種方法在github中做線上Demo演示
作為一個前端工程師,平常寫一些小demo或專案時會遇到這樣的情況:我想把這個html頁面呈現給別人看看,又不想把整個工程專案發給他,這樣太麻煩,要是有個能線上演示demo的平臺就好了。OK,github可以幫我們,一切都不是問題。 把github上的i
線程的啟動的兩種方法,Runnable接口,run()的調用
ride 之前 線程終止 源碼解析 star 有意 tro thread類 override 實現並啟動線程有兩種方法1、寫一個類繼承自Thread類,重寫run方法。用start方法啟動線程2、寫一個類實現Runnable接口,實現run方法。用new Thread(Ru
安裝軟體包的三種方法、 rpm、yum 工具用法、yum搭建本地倉庫
一、安裝軟體包的三種方法 rpm工具:是RPM Package Manager(RPM軟體包管理器)的縮寫 yum工具:全稱為 Yellow dog Updater, Modified)是一個在Fedora和RedHat以及CentOS中的Shell前端軟體包管理器。基於
機器學習兩種方法——監督學習和無監督學習(通俗理解)
前言 機器學習分為:監督學習,無監督學習,半監督學習(也可以用hinton所說的強化學習)等。 在這裡,主要理解一下監督學習和無監督學習。 監督學習(supervised learning) 從給定的訓練資料集中學習出一個函式(模型引數),當新的資料到來時,可以根據這個函式
SQL 查詢並拼接欄位的兩種方法主要用於多級分類表格顯示(一級/二級/三級/)
表A(id,name,typeid) 表B(typeid,parentid,tnam) 第一種:用CASE WHEN THEN判斷 SELECT CASE WHEN b.parentid IS NULL THEN b.tname WHEN b1.typeid IS NOT N
圖 | 兩種遍歷方式:深度優先搜尋(DFS、深搜)和廣度優先搜尋(BFS、廣搜)
前邊介紹了有關圖的 4 種儲存方式,本節介紹如何對儲存的圖中的頂點進行遍歷。常用的遍歷方式有兩種:深度優先搜尋和廣度優先搜尋。 深度優先搜尋(簡稱“深搜”或DFS) 圖 1 無向圖 深度優先搜尋的過程類似於樹的先序遍歷,首先從例
兩種方式實現多執行緒共享資源(典型的售票例子)
1、繼承Thread TestThread類 public class TestThread extends Thread{ private int ticket = 300; @Override public void run() { while(true){
git刪除遠端分支檔案,不改變本地檔案
git提交專案時候踩的Git的坑 經歷 由於剛開始沒有設定.gitignore檔案,導致專案中所有的檔案都被提交到了github上面,由此帶來的問題就是有些debug日誌也被提交了上去,對於團隊開發很不友好。 一個錯誤的嘗試 git rm -r --cached "fileName/direction
最常用的兩種C++序列化方案的使用心得(protobuf和boost serialization)
最常用的兩種C++序列化方案的使用心得(protobuf和boost serialization) 導讀 1. 什麼是序列化?
鏈表有環判斷,快慢指針兩種方法/合並鏈表/刪除重復元素/二分遞歸和while
pan 快慢指針 fast public nbsp else pre log clas public static boolean hasCycle(ListNode head) { if (head == null || head.next ==
Flask 設定cookie的兩種方法.獲取cookie,和刪除cookie的方法(修改過期時間)
設定cookie 方法一: 建立物件 make_response的物件 呼叫物件 的set_cookie方法設定cookie 方法二: 直接設定表單頭 除了鍵值對,其他部分可去瀏覽器檢查摘抄 resp.headers["Set-Cook
如果頁面表格裡的內容過長,設定隱藏顯示的兩種方法
方法一 我使用了方法一但是沒有成功,問題是表格的寬度會隨著內容的長短而變化,找不到問題的癥結所以嘗試的方法二。 方法二: 做法基本上和方法一相同,最重要的區別是方法二藉助div實現,具體如下: 1>jsp頁面上程式碼: <td class="la" ><div
JS刪除JSON陣列中的元素的兩種方法:delete和splice
最近的需求中,需要從JSON陣列中刪除元素,之前不太瞭解,特地查了一下,總結一下: splice(startIndex,count);這個方法用於從陣列的第startIndex位開始,刪除count個元素。 說明: 1、滿足條件的元素直接被刪除,腳標重信排 2、sta
Windows遠端連線Linux介面的兩種方法
使用VNC連線,最簡單. 首先在linux端鍵入命令安裝vncserver #yum -y install vnc *vnc-server* 然後鍵入命令設定vncserver密碼 #vncpasswd 然後鍵入命令來檢視當前的vncserver埠 #vncserver 可以看
MySQL資料庫遠端訪問許可權如何開啟(兩種方法)
在我們使用mysql資料庫時,有時我們的程式與資料庫不在同一機器上,這時我們需要遠端訪問資料庫。預設狀態下,mysql的使用者沒有遠端訪問的許可權。 下面介紹兩種方法,解決這一問題。 1、改表法 可能是你的帳號不允許從遠端登陸,只能在localhost。這個時候只要
限制一個遠端會話的使用者(可用兩種方法實現)
要執行該過程,你必須是本地計算機上 Administrators 組的成員,或者你必須被委派了相應的許可權。如果計算機已加入某個域,則 Domain Admins 組的成員可能會執行該過程。作為最安全的操作,請考慮使用“執行方式”執行此過程。有關詳細資訊,請參閱預設本地組、預設組以及使用“執行方式”。 使用以